What they do

A Preschool or Childcare Teacher works with young children, usually ages 3 - 5, to help them learn the social, motor and language skills needed to be ready for kindergarten and elementary school. Organizes activities and uses play or games to help children learn; develops schedules and routines for children that include exercise and rest. Works in a school or in a childcare center or program.

Job Description

Position Overview:
We are looking for a fun-loving, energetic, and dedicated Preschool Teacher who loves working with young children and brings enthusiasm to the classroom every day. If you enjoy hands-on play, foster a positive and inclusive team environment, and want to help build a strong foundation of faith and learning for young minds, we would love to meet you!
Key Responsibilities:
Create a joyful, play-based learning environment that encourages curiosity and social-emotional growth. Integrate faith-based values and gentle guidance into daily routines and play activities. Collaborate closely with co-teachers and staff to plan creative activities and maintain a supportive team culture. Engage actively with children through play, games, outdoor exploration, and creative projects. Communicate warmly and effectively with parents about their child's day and development. Participate in staff meetings, scheduled in-service days, and professional growth opportunities.
Qualifications:
Passion for early childhood education and a genuine love for working with young children. Strong team-player mindset with a warm, positive, and flexible attitude. Experience in a preschool or early childhood setting (preferred). Coursework or units in Early Childhood Education (ECE) as required by state regulations. Alignment with our faith-based mission and play-based learning philosophy.
